Turning a hobby into a successful business is a dream many people entertain but few achieve. The process requires more than just passion—it takes strategy, discipline, and an understanding of the business landscape. While doing what you love for a living sounds ideal, the transition from a pastime to a profitable venture comes with unique challenges. If you want to monetize your hobby and build something sustainable, you’ll need a combination of creativity, resilience, and smart decision-making. Here’s what it takes to turn what you love into a flourishing enterprise.
Master Your Craft Before Monetizing It
Before you introduce your hobby to the marketplace, you must ensure that your skills are refined enough to compete. Passion alone won’t cut it—customers are drawn to expertise, quality, and professionalism. Whether you create handmade goods, offer a service, or teach a skill, continuous improvement is essential. Take the time to perfect your techniques, invest in better tools, and stay updated with trends in your niche. The stronger your skillset, the more confidence you’ll have when presenting your product or service to potential buyers.
Understand Your Target Market
Even the most passionate business idea can fail without the right audience. You need to know who will buy what you offer and why. Conduct market research to understand customer needs, pricing expectations, and buying habits. Are there existing businesses offering similar products or services? What gaps can you fill? By identifying your target demographic, you can tailor your branding, pricing, and marketing strategy to appeal to the right people. A well-defined audience ensures you’re not just creating for yourself, but for a community that values your work.
Create a Strong Brand Identity
Your brand is more than just a name and logo—it’s the personality and message that make your business memorable. A compelling brand identity helps build trust and connection with customers. Think about what makes your hobby-turned-business unique and how you want to be perceived. Everything from your business name to your social media presence should align with a clear vision. Consistency in design, tone, and storytelling strengthens recognition and positions you as a serious entrepreneur rather than just a hobbyist.
Balance Passion with Profitability
Loving what you do is important, but if your business isn’t making money, it won’t last. One of the biggest challenges in turning a hobby into a business is learning to separate personal enjoyment from financial sustainability. Pricing your products or services correctly, managing expenses, and tracking profits are crucial steps. It’s easy to undervalue your work, especially when you start, but treating your passion like a real business means charging what it’s worth. Developing a strong pricing strategy ensures that you’re not just covering costs but making a meaningful profit.

Build an Online Presence
A strong online presence is non-negotiable for success. Whether you sell products or offer services, social media, websites, and online marketplaces provide access to a wider audience. Content marketing, such as blogs, videos, and tutorials, can showcase your expertise and attract potential customers. Engaging with your audience through social media helps build a loyal community around your brand. Learning how to market effectively allows you to reach more people, generate interest, and turn your passion into a thriving business.
Develop a Business Mindset
A common mistake hobbyists make is approaching their business with a casual mindset. Success requires shifting from a creative perspective to an entrepreneurial one. This means understanding financial management, setting goals, and making strategic decisions. You’ll need to handle everything from budgeting to customer service to inventory management. Embracing the challenges of running a business, rather than just focusing on the fun parts, sets you apart from those who never make it past the hobby stage. Treating your passion like a serious venture increases your chances of long-term success.

Scale and Adapt for Growth
Once your business gains traction, you’ll need to think about expansion. Scaling your hobby-turned-business might involve outsourcing tasks, automating processes, or diversifying your offerings. Growth requires adaptability—what works in the beginning might not work forever. Keeping up with trends, improving efficiency, and seeking customer feedback helps refine your business model. The ability to pivot when necessary and explore new opportunities ensures that your venture continues to evolve and thrive.
Transforming a hobby into a successful business is about more than just doing what you love—it’s about making strategic moves that turn passion into profit. With dedication, persistence, and the right strategy, you can turn your favorite pastime into a profitable and fulfilling career.
